The Traffic Assignment Problem Models and Methods Dover ~ From the Back Cover This monograph provides both a unified account of the development of models and methods for the problem of estimating equilibrium traffic flows in urban areas and a survey of the scope and limitations of present traffic models

The Traffic Assignment Problem Models and Methods ~ The development is described and analyzed by the use of the powerful instruments of nonlinear optimization and mathematical programming within the field of operations research The first part is devoted to mathematical models for the analysis of transportation network equilibria the second deals with methods for traffic equilibrium problems
